Transaction 3656c03d52295410988cf325d736aaf563132778160dcc675a286be11a73a39e
1 Input
1 Output
-
3656c03d52295410988cf325d736aaf563132778160dcc675a286be11a73a39e:0
- value
- 29592108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0272b278eeb9d5e1f8a5ae0dd8699ee8888bc4f7 OP_EQUAL
- address
- 31uxgE3LRBr84WDuBMDTMGyTKAtoUxhvE9